Emptying the condensate trap
The condensate consists of a weak mix of acids. Avoid contact with the skin. Make
sure that the condensate does not run over the housing.

1 Hold the measuring instrument so that the
condensate outlet points up.
2 Open condensate outlet in condensate trap: Pull
out approx. 5mm or until it will not go any further
( ).
3 Let the condensate run out into a sink ( ).
4 Dab off drops at condensate outlet using a cloth.
5 Close the condensate outlet.
The condensate outlet must be fully closed (mark-
ing) otherwise incorrect measurements due to
inleaking air may result.
